From a marketing point of view, the Internet is considered by many to be no different from any other communication medium. In reality it can be dramatically cheaper and it has a phenomenally larger reach for small/medium sized businesses and organisations. In fact it's Global.
The Internet is an interactive communication medium.
Your web audience, your web customers can't just sit back and get spoon
fed your message. They have to actively seek you out.
The Internet is an interactive, 'unstratified', communication medium.
The web can be used to communicate one to one or just as easily one to millions.
There are no cost barriers to your broadcast reach. There is an abundance
of choices and voices in this 'democratic' world.
The Internet is an interactive, 'unstratified', multi-channelled,
communication medium.
There are a multitude of ways to get your message across: emails, instant
messaging, chat rooms, mobile picture and text messaging, message
boards, forums, blogs, social network sites, video conferencing, remote
presentations, viral campaigns, text advertisements, banner advertisements,
RSS feeds, and of course websites. The methods of delivering your
message are only limited by time and imagination.
Before you start thinking of a website or web presence you need to do some serious mental exercises with your grey matter. You need to think of how your business or organisation is going to be found. How are you going to establish an Internet presence? Unlike TV, radio, publishing or direct marketing there are no guaranteed audience figures to pitch your message to on the Internet. What there is is some 8 billion plus web pages sitting in cyberspace. Islands of information and chatter. Your customers have to pick you out. It is not an easy prospect.
Unless the web address pointing to your website is 'known' on the Internet or 'known' to your customers in the 'conventional' world offline your voice will never be heard. Sadly this is the fate of countless small businesses.
